Who remembers the story took place during the Black Friday of last year, linked to the poker room Full Tilt Poker? As you know, due to the closure of the poker room, many poker players were forced to go elsewhere.
Today, we learned that the PRO poker player, Phil Ivey is back on FTP, in a new guise, or rather nickname, but it did not take much to expose him. The nickname you are currently using is Polarizing, to unmask his identity we thought poker.org a site user who has received an email from FTP which reads:
Hi, we contact on an opponent who challenged recently, Phil Ivey, as you certainly know, we do not allow players to change the nickname, except in rare cases. We made the decision based on some considerations to change the nickname. For this reason, the player in question is called Polarizing, we decided to inform you of this change to get to know his new identity.
In practice, the email is automatic or not, this is not given to know, informed the player that his opponent has changed its nickname, but in this case the opponent in question is Phil Ivey. Now everyone knows that there is the possibility of running in a game against Phil Ivey. The well-known player is back on FTP, after more than one year, the events that led to the closing and opening of FTP under the supervision of a new manager.
